Step 1: Containment

Our team will contain the affected area to prevent sewage water from spreading. This involves setting up barriers and sealing off any affected areas to prevent further damage.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and ensuring your home is safe to live in.

Step 2: Moisture Detection

Our team will use advanced equipment to detect moisture in your home. This includes mo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ras that can detect even the smallest amounts of moisture. This helps us identify where the water has traveled and how to best dry your home.

Step 3: Drying

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your home quickly and efficiently. This includes high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ers that can remove up to 30 gallons of water per day. This helps prevent further damage and ensures your home is dry and safe to live in.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Our team will clean and disinfect the affected area to remove any remaining sewage odors and bacteria. This includes using specialized cleaning products and equipment to ensure your home is safe and healthy. This is an important step in preventing the spread of bacteria and odors.

Sewage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
You notice a small leak under your sink. Yes No You can fix it yourself with some basic plumbing tools.
You experience a large flood in your basement. No Yes You need professional equipment and expertise to contain and dry the area.
You notice a musty odor coming from your laundry room. No Yes You need professional help to detect and remove the source of the odor.
You have a small water stain on your ceiling. Yes No You can fix it yourself with some basic repair tools.
You experience a sewage backup in your home. No Yes You need professional help to contain and clean the area.
You notice a high water bill without explanation. No Yes You need professional help to detect and fix the source of the leak.

With sewage water extraction, it’s always best to err on the side of caution and call a professional. Don’t risk further damage and health risks by trying to fix the problem yourself.

Sewage Water Extraction Cost in Anna, TX

The cost of sewage water extraction in Anna,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and can be provided after an on-site assessment. Here are some estimated costs for common sewage water extraction services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and complexity of containment
Moisture Detection $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of equipment used
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and type of equipment used
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ning products used
Rem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of remediation required
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area and type of restoration required

Exact pricing will depend on the specifics of your job and will be provided after an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and are happy to discuss your project with you.
